Revitalization of Historical Architecture in Nihonbashi Kabutocho and Kayabacho to Create Vibrant Spaces

Revitalizing Nihonbashi's Historical Landscape



In the heart of Tokyo, the Nihonbashi Kabutocho and Kayabacho areas are undergoing a remarkable transformation. Leveraging the Tokyo Metropolitan Government's 'Renovation Model Project,' Peace Realty Co. has embarked on a revitalization journey, breathing new life into the existing low-rise buildings through thoughtful renovations. The goal is not just to update the structures but to enhance the streetscape, merging historical architecture with contemporary design, thereby creating vibrant urban spaces.

A Commitment to Community and Culture


Peace Realty, headquartered in Chuo, Tokyo, has been dedicated to enhancing the cultural and historical significance of the Nihonbashi area. The company believes that by respecting and promoting the rich history and culture of the neighborhood, they can attract new businesses and cultivate spaces for community interaction. This renovation project is seen as an opportunity to honor the historical spirit of the area while introducing elements that foster new community engagement.

The renovations include an open facade design that allows glimpses of human activity within the stores, promoting a lively street presence. The exterior has been meticulously crafted, removing cladding to reveal the original mosaic tiles, echoing the architectural details of the early 20th century buildings surrounding it. The design encourages foot traffic and engagement, making the street a welcoming environment.

Architectural Design and Highlights


The renovation at the Kabutocho Heiwa Building is set against a backdrop of historically significant architecture, including the K5 building (completed in 1923) and the Nichoshokai building (completed in 1928). Key elements of the design include:
  • - Continuation of Historical Features: The renovation has retained and highlighted distinctive architectural features, preserving the historical essence of the area.
  • - Creating Welcoming Spaces: New waiting areas, benches, and open spaces invite passersby to linger, creating a sense of community and shared purpose.
  • - Fluid Transition Between Spaces: The design creates continuity with surrounding structures, offering a harmonious transition that blends old and new.

Images showcasing the transformation are vital in illustrating the contrast between the original building facades and their renovated counterparts. The renovation process itself reflects an ethos that prioritizes historic preservation while making spaces more functional for modern use.

The Role of the 'Renovation Model Project'


The renovation of the Kabutocho Heiwa Building is part of the Tokyo Metropolitan Government's 'Renovation Model Project,' which aids private developers in pioneering advanced renovation efforts. This initiative serves to support projects that breathe new life into areas rich with historical significance, ensuring that the knowledge gained through these renovations can influence future urban development efforts across the city. The project's commitment extends beyond mere financial backing; it aims to generate innovative case studies that can inspire future urban planners.

Facilities and Retail Opportunities


The property, strategically located at 3-3 Kabutocho, Chuo, Tokyo, now houses various retail spaces:
  • - South Store: Chokkan - A fashion pop-up space
  • - North Store: TYNK Kabutocho - A dining venue specializing in craft herbal teas and chai

Both stores are positioned to complement the revitalized community atmosphere, providing unique offerings that attract both locals and visitors.
